Meet Your mentor!
Nica Cosio is an arts and crafts mentor with over 10 years of teaching children, teens and adults in both group workshops and one-on-one settings. Her workshops, which revolve around collage, printmaking, creative journaling and paper crafts, have been conducted in collaboration with different educational platforms, cultural organizations, and community programs. As a homeschooling mom of three and someone who was homeschooled from an early age herself, she believes in self-directed learning and in the importance of adapting lessons to different learning styles and developmental stages. She currently runs a collaborative co-working studio with her husband called Honeycomb Manila where they also organize community-building events.
